The cosmic display, which occurs each year from September to November, is created when Earth passes through a broad stream or swarm of pebble-sized fragments from the Comet Encke that then burn up in the atmosphere. A meteorite that fell onto the roof of a house in Novato, California, on Oct. 17, 2012, has revealed a detailed picture of its origin and tumultuous journey through space and Earth's atmosphere. An international consortium of fifty researchers studied the fallen meteorite and published their findings in the August issue of the journal Meteoritics and Planetary Science.
